![]() | Re: Disney at Comic-Con 2009 Sunday, July 26 10:00-11:00 Phineas & Ferb— Hey kids, whatcha doin'? Going to the Phineas and Ferb panel, that's what! Creators Dan Povenmire (Family Guy) and Jeff "Swampy" Marsh (Rocko's Modern Life) plus the voice of Phineas, Vincent Martella (Everybody Hates Chris) and other surprise guests from the show are on hand to tell you everything that's happening behind the scenes of Disney Channel and Disney XD's #1 animated series. You'll get to see sneak peeks of new episodes, new songs, plus prizes, giveaways, and juggling chainsaws (okay, maybe not that last one). ![]() | Re: Disney at Comic-Con 2009 UPDATE - TIME CHANGE Date: Thursday, July 23 NEW Time: 3:00 - 4:00 p.m. Location: Room 32AB, San Diego Convention Center For more information: Comic-Con 2009 :: What's New AnimationMentor.com and Don Hahn of The Walt Disney Studios announced an inspiring panel discussion at Comic-Con International with acclaimed animators about the life and influence of Disney mentor, teacher, and artist Walt Stanchfield. Open to animators and animation enthusiasts alike, the panel discussion celebrates the launch of the new book, DRAWN TO LIFE: 20 GOLDEN YEARS OF DISNEY MASTER CLASSES, the complete series of animation lectures by Walt Stanchfield. "Walt Stanchfield has contributed so much to the animation industry through his incredible body of work and the mentorship of a generation of phenomenal animators," said Bobby Beck, chief executive officer and cofounder of Animation Mentor. "This panel is an amazing opportunity to hear the best animators of our time talk about the influence Walt had on their life and work as well as share insightful lessons that are highlighted in the book, DRAWN TO LIFE." Moderator Don Hahn, The Walt Disney Studios Don Hahn is a two-time Academy Award nominee and film producer responsible for producing some of the most successful Walt Disney Animated films of the past 20 years, including BEAUTY AND THE BEAST and THE LION KING. Panelists Glen Keane, Walt Disney Animation Studios Glen Keane is an animator, author, illustrator and director. He is currently executive producer and animation director for Disney's Rapunzel. Keane is best known for his character animation in Disney classics, including THE LITTLE MERMAID, ALADDIN, BEAUTY AND THE BEAST and TARZAN. Eric Goldberg, Walt Disney Animation Studios Eric Goldberg is an animator and film director who is currently supervising animator for Disney's upcoming 2D feature THE PRINCESS AND THE FROG. Creator of ALADDIN's Genie, he was the supervising animator for Phil in HERCULES and co-director of POCAHONTAS. Goldberg is also the author of the book CHARACTER ANIMATION CRASH COURSE. Tom Sito, Professor and Animator Tom Sito is a 30-year veteran of animated film production. He divides his time as a professional animator and adjunct professor of animation at University of California Los Angeles and University of Southern California and lecturing on animation. Ruben Procopio, Masked Avenger Studios Ruben Procopio began his animation career at Disney at age 18, where he trained under Eric Larson, one of Disney's legendary "Nine Old Men". His film credits include THE LITTLE MERMAID, BEAUTY AND THE BEAST, ALADDIN and THE LION KING. In 2003, Procopio founded Masked Avenger Studios, which provides sculpture, design, comics and animation services. Published for the first time, DRAWN TO LIFE is a two-volume collection of the legendary lectures from longtime Disney animator Walt Stanchfield. For over 20 years, Walt helped breathe life into the new golden age of animation with these teachings at the Walt Disney Animation Studios and influenced such talented artists as Tim Burton, Brad Bird, Glen Keane, and John Lasseter. This book represents the quintessential refresher for fine artists and film professionals, and is a vital tutorial for students who are now poised to be part of another new generation in the art form. |

![]() | Re: Disney at Comic-Con 2009 Saturday, July 25 11:15-12:30 Quick Draw!— We say it each and every year, but it's true: Quick Draw is the most fun panel you can visit at Comic-Con. Mark Evanier puts Sergio Aragonés, Scott Shaw!, and this year's guest artist, Disney Legend Floyd Norman, through their paces as they draw on the big screen. If you haven't seen this amazing display of cartooning magic, this is the year for you: join the fun! Room 6BCF Comic-Con 2009 :: Programming for Saturday, July 25 |
